[ARCHIVED] Residents can sponsor benches, other fixtures in downtown Victoria

A metal bench. A plaque propped up on the bench has the Main Street logo and a sample inscription.

PHOTO: The Victoria Main Street Program Board of Directors is selling sponsorships of benches and other downtown fixtures to raise funds for public art initiatives.

The Victoria Main Street Program Board of Directors is seeking sponsors to help bring more public art downtown by purchasing dedications of benches and other fixtures.

The board is selling a limited number of sponsorships for the following:

  • Lampposts
  • Planters
  • Heritage benches (to be located at the City Hall courtyard)
  • Kaspar benches (to be located elsewhere downtown)

Each of the fixtures will have a plaque inscribed with the sponsor’s dedication.

Proceeds from the sale of sponsorships will be used to fund future public art initiatives in downtown Victoria.

“By sponsoring a bench, planter or lamppost, you not only will add art to the Victoria downtown area, but you will also leave a legacy for yourself or someone you care about,” said Board President Pam Edge.

Making moves for public art

A group of people talking and laughing in a wide open room with other people in the background.PHOTO:  The Victoria Main Street Program Board of Directors hosted “The City of Roses Celebration,” a ticketed social event to raise funds for public art initiatives, Sept. 4 at Hause Venue.

The sponsorship program was unveiled during “The City of Roses Celebration,” a ticketed social event that was held Sept. 4 at Hause Venue to raise funds for public art initiatives.

Also during the event, the board displayed artwork that was submitted during the board’s recent call for artists. Soon, the board will announce the selected artwork to be displayed in downtown Victoria, and residents will be able to vote on their favorites.
